2025 Ferrari SF90 XX Stradale & Spider: The Apex of Electrified Italian Passion
Even within Ferrari’s already select roster of high-performance machines, the designation “XX” signifies a profound elevation in track-focused capability and exclusivity. Building upon the groundbreaking SF90 Stradale, the SF90 XX variant represents an even more extreme iteration, meticulously engineered to extract every conceivable fraction of performance. Available in both the fixed-roof Stradale and the open-air Spider configurations, these are not merely cars; they are potent expressions of Maranello’s relentless pursuit of automotive perfection.
The heart of the SF90 XX is a hybrid powertrain that masterfully blends the visceral ferocity of a twin-turbocharged V8 engine with the instant torque and silent propulsion of three electric motors. This formidable collaboration yields an astonishing 1,036 horsepower, a substantial increase over its standard sibling, translating into breathtaking acceleration. Expect to witness the 0-60 mph sprint obliterated in a mere 2.3 seconds, with a top speed of 211 mph. Aggressive aerodynamic enhancements, meticulously sculpted from advanced composites, not only define its menacing aesthetic but are crucial in maximizing downforce and stability at extreme velocities. The estimated price tag of $890,000 positions the SF90 XX as a benchmark for hypercar performance and exclusivity, with a production run of just 1,398 units (799 Stradale and 599 Spider) underscoring its rarity.
2025 Gordon Murray Automotive T.33: A Purist’s Delight in a Hybrid World
In an automotive landscape increasingly dominated by hybridization and electrification, Gordon Murray Automotive (GMA) champions a more traditional, yet no less exhilarating, approach with its T.33. While perhaps positioned as an “entry-level” offering within GMA’s limited portfolio, this statement belies the T.33’s extraordinary engineering and performance credentials. It shares its foundational powertrain architecture with the acclaimed T.50, though it’s tuned for a slightly more accessible, yet still formidable, 607 horsepower from its naturally aspirated V12 engine.
What truly sets the T.33 apart in the contemporary hypercar conversation is its unapologetic embrace of a six-speed manual transmission. This offers an engaging and visceral connection between driver and machine that is rapidly becoming a relic of the past. Eschewing the radical fan-based aerodynamics of the T.50, the T.33 adopts a more conventional, yet elegantly executed, two-seat roadster layout. This focus on driver engagement, coupled with its exceptional powertrain and feather-light construction, makes the T.33 a compelling proposition for those who cherish the art of driving. With a production cap of just 100 units and an estimated price of $1.72 million, the T.33 represents a significant investment in automotive purity and driving pleasure.
2025 Koenigsegg Gemera: The Four-Seat Hypercar Revolution
Christian von Koenigsegg’s name is synonymous with pushing the boundaries of automotive engineering, and the Gemera is perhaps his most audacious statement yet. This is not merely a hypercar; it is a revolutionary concept that redefines practicality within the extreme performance segment. Its most striking departure from convention is its four-seat cockpit, accessed through distinctive dihedral doors, offering an unprecedented level of passenger accommodation for a vehicle of this caliber.
The Gemera’s powertrain is as innovative as its seating arrangement. It offers a multi-faceted approach to propulsion, capable of running on gasoline, electric power, or a combination of both. The standard configuration already delivers a colossal 1,381 horsepower. However, for those who demand the ultimate expression of speed, Koenigsegg offers an optional V8 engine paired with an electric motor, catapulting the Gemera’s output to an astonishing 2,269 horsepower. Introduced in 2020, the Gemera has seen continuous refinement, solidifying its position as a unique and highly sought-after hypercar. With an estimated price of $1.7 million and a planned production run of 300 units, the Gemera offers a glimpse into the future of high-performance, yet surprisingly practical, automotive design.
2026 McLaren W1: A Hybrid Masterpiece Evolving from Racing Pedigree
McLaren has a storied history of producing cars that transcend mere transportation, and the W1 stands as a testament to this legacy. Following in the hallowed footsteps of legends like the McLaren F1 and P1, the W1 is a limited-production hybrid hypercar that embodies the culmination of lessons learned from their most exclusive models, including the track-focused McLaren Senna. With all 399 planned units already spoken for, its desirability is evident.
The W1’s powertrain is a symphony of forced induction and electric augmentation, featuring a potent 4.0-liter twin-turbocharged V8 engine meticulously integrated with an electric motor. This potent partnership unleashes a staggering 1,258 horsepower and 988 pound-feet of torque. Its performance is equally dramatic, capable of accelerating from 0 to 60 mph in a mere 2.7 seconds, with a top speed reaching 217 mph. As a plug-in hybrid, it offers a silent electric-only range of approximately two miles, providing a discreet departure from the garage. The W1 represents McLaren’s ongoing commitment to developing cutting-edge hybrid technology for road-going hypercars, pushing the boundaries of what’s possible. The projected price for this extraordinary machine is $2.1 million.
2025 Rimac Nevera R: The Electric Hypercar Redefined
For those who believe that the blistering acceleration of even the most potent electric road cars is insufficient, Rimac Automobili offers a compelling, and electrically charged, solution. The Nevera, the successor to the CTwo, is the brainchild of the Croatian EV hypercar manufacturer, renowned for its relentless pursuit of electric performance. At its core lies a substantial 120 kWh Lithium Nickel Manganese Cobalt Oxide battery, feeding four high-performance electric motors strategically placed at each wheel. This configuration unleashes a colossal 1,813 horsepower and 1,741 pound-feet of torque.
The introduction of the 2025 Nevera R elevates these already prodigious figures to an astonishing 2,107 horsepower, pushing the boundaries of electric propulsion. The sheer force generated means the Nevera can rocket from 0 to 60 mph in an almost unfathomable 1.85 seconds, with the upgraded R model achieving the same feat in a scarcely believable 1.74 seconds. The quarter-mile is dispatched in a mere 8.6 seconds. The advanced battery system supports 350-kWh fast charging, allowing for a 20% to 80% charge in just 18 minutes. While its official range is 205 miles on a full charge, aggressive driving will naturally reduce this figure. The Rimac Nevera R, with a price of $2.5 million and a production run limited to just 40 units, stands as a monumental achievement in electric hypercar engineering.
2025 Pininfarina Battista: Italian Design Meets Electric Power
Pininfarina, an icon of automotive design, has etched its name in the annals of automotive history through decades of breathtaking creations for legendary brands. The Battista marks a monumental milestone as their very first standalone production car, aptly named after its founder, Battista “Pinin” Farina. Sharing its fundamental EV powertrain architecture with the Rimac Nevera, the Battista benefits from a dedicated focus on chassis engineering and underpinnings to ensure a distinct and captivating driving experience.
Constructed around a full carbon fiber monocoque and adorned with carbon fiber body panels, the Battista prioritizes lightweight strength and structural rigidity. Its quartet of electric motors, one at each wheel, combine to produce an astounding 1,900 horsepower, enabling a zero-to-60-mph sprint in a mere 1.8 seconds. A unique feature is the integration of speakers within the cabin designed to replicate the sonorous roar of a traditional internal combustion engine, offering a personalized auditory experience. With a price point of $2.4 million and a production limit of 150 units, the Pininfarina Battista stands as a harmonious fusion of timeless Italian design and cutting-edge electric performance.
2025 Koenigsegg Jesko Absolut: The Pursuit of Hyper-Velocity
From the visionary mind of Christian von Koenigsegg emerges the Jesko, a hypercar that consistently redefines the upper echelons of performance. The Jesko Absolut, a specialized variant, is engineered with a singular focus: achieving speeds previously confined to theoretical calculations. Its heart is a potent twin-turbocharged 5.0-liter V8 engine. Running on premium gasoline, it produces 1,280 horsepower, a figure that escalates to an awe-inspiring 1,600 horsepower when fueled by E85 biofuel. Power is seamlessly managed through a sophisticated nine-speed multi-clutch transmission. Koenigsegg boldly claims a theoretical top speed exceeding 300 mph for the Jesko when utilizing E85.
The Jesko Absolut’s design is a masterful blend of form and function, featuring dramatic aerodynamic elements like its central rear spoiler and active aerodynamic surfaces. These, combined with its immense power output and robust braking system, have propelled the Jesko Absolut to achieve multiple world records, including the dizzying feats of 0-250 mph, 0-400 km/h, 0-250-0 mph, and 0-400-0 km/h. It has also registered a verified top speed of 256 mph. With a price of $3.4 million and a production run of 125 units, the Jesko Absolut represents the pinnacle of automotive speed engineering.
2025 Gordon Murray T.50: A Tribute to Driving Purity
Gordon Murray’s illustrious career in motorsport is marked by groundbreaking designs that have secured endurance race victories and Formula One championships. Now, through his eponymous company, Murray continues to innovate with creations like the T.50, a vehicle deeply informed by his unparalleled racing pedigree and road-going experience. In an era saturated with hybrid and electric powertrains, the T.50 stands as a proud champion of the naturally aspirated internal combustion engine.
Its heart is a glorious 3.9-liter V12 engine, eschewing forced induction, that generates 661 horsepower. This potent unit is artfully paired with a wonderfully old-fashioned six-speed manual transmission, offering an unadulterated connection to the driving process. A signature feature of the T.50 is its unique integrated fan system. This sophisticated mechanism actively channels airflow through the car’s bodywork, generating significant downforce that enhances stability during high-speed runs and tenacious cornering. Murray emphatically asserts that the T.50 is engineered to deliver one of the most immersive and connected driving experiences that money can buy. Priced at $3.2 million with a limited production of 100 units, the T.50 is a collector’s dream and a driver’s ultimate reward.
2025 Aston Martin Valkyrie Spider: Formula 1 Technology for the Road
Aston Martin’s fascination with Norse mythology is evident in its hypercar lineup, with the Valkyrie standing as a more extreme and exclusive precursor to the Valhalla. Following the successful debut of its fixed-roof sibling, Aston Martin unveiled the Spider variant of the Valkyrie at the prestigious 2021 Pebble Beach Concours d’Elegance. This open-top iteration features a single, removable roof panel, emphasizing its track-focused ethos.
The Valkyrie is propelled by a hybrid powertrain that harmoniously integrates a Cosworth-developed 6.5-liter V12 engine with electric assistance, resulting in a combined output of 1,139 horsepower. This machine is so exceptionally engineered that Aston Martin has ambitious plans to campaign it in the demanding 24 Hours of Le Mans and the IMSA racing series, validating its race-bred capabilities. The Aston Martin Valkyrie Spider, with a price of $4 million and a production run limited to 85 units, represents a true fusion of Formula 1 technology and road-legal hypercar artistry.
Pininfarina B95: The Open-Top Electrified Track Weapon
While the Pininfarina Battista represents their more conventional production model, the B95 takes exclusivity and radical design to an entirely new level. Pininfarina describes the B95 as an “open-ski” hypercar, essentially an open-top, minimalist machine that channels race-ready technology directly onto the road. Its most striking visual departure is the complete absence of a traditional windshield, implying that occupants are expected to utilize protective head and eyewear.
The B95 often sports a distinctive jet-inspired yellow and graphite livery, though custom collaborations, such as the “Gotham” variant with Warner Bros. Discovery, showcase its bespoke potential. Powered by four electric motors delivering nearly 1,900 horsepower, and capable of achieving 0-60 mph in under two seconds, the B95 offers performance that rivals that of a fighter jet. With a price tag of $4.8 million and an extremely limited production of just 10 units, the Pininfarina B95 is an unparalleled statement of automotive individuality and extreme electric performance.
Red Bull RB17: Formula 1 Dominance Unleashed
From the very team that has dominated Formula 1 circuits for years, Red Bull Racing, comes the RB17 – a hypercar designed exclusively for track use. Spearheaded by the legendary F1 engineer Adrian Newey, the RB17 is a veritable blueprint of F1 technology, featuring advanced active aerodynamics and sophisticated ground effects. Red Bull has partnered with Michelin to develop bespoke tires capable of handling the extraordinary demands placed upon them.
The RB17’s hybrid powertrain unites a 1,000-horsepower V10 engine with an electric motor, generating a combined output of 1,200 horsepower. Crucially, the RB17 boasts an astonishingly low curb weight of just 1,984 pounds. This remarkable power-to-weight ratio is expected to enable it to lap circuits with the same ferocity as Formula 1 cars, with a projected top speed of 217 mph. Priced at $6.8 million and limited to just 50 units, the Red Bull RB17 is an unprecedented opportunity to own a piece of Formula 1’s engineering brilliance.
Rolls-Royce Droptail: Bespoke Aristocracy Personified
The pinnacle of bespoke luxury, the Rolls-Royce Droptail represents the zenith of the brand’s exclusive Coachbuild series. Only four of these extraordinary roadsters will ever be meticulously crafted, with each being an entirely unique commission, tailored precisely to the individual desires of its owner. The inaugural model, the La Rose Noire Droptail, draws inspiration from the Black Baccara rose and features a mesmerizing “True Love” paint finish that shimmers with deep red hues under varying light conditions.
The interior craftsmanship of the Droptail is simply unparalleled. It features an astonishing 1,603 meticulously hand-finished wood veneer pieces, artfully arranged to evoke the delicate form of rose petals. Further elevating its exclusivity, the Droptail incorporates a removable Audemars Piguet timepiece, a jewel-like control set, and a host of other bespoke elements, each contributing to an atmosphere of unrivaled opulence. With each of the four units representing a custom creation and priced at a staggering $32 million, the Rolls-Royce Droptail is not merely a car; it is a mobile work of art, a testament to ultimate automotive personalization and aristocratic elegance.
